Clifton Village has long been one of the most desirable neighbourhoods in Bristol with its highly regarded restaurants, independent shops, and beautiful architecture. Restaurants and cafes such as Kibou and Foliage Cafe strike a pleasant contrast to the well established and ever popular Coronation Tap, Portcullis Pub, and beautiful views of the Avon Gorge Hotel. There is plenty of green space right on your doorstep with The Downs in walking distance and Ashton Court just over the iconic Bristol Suspension Bridge. Clifton Village is also conveniently located close to Bristol City Centre and the rapidly expanding Bristol Harbourside which has attracted a number of large employers. For those looking for a day out South of the river, North Street is a 20 minute walk across the impressive Greville Smyth Park and offers many independent bars and restaurants and is well known for its wealth of Street Art.



At over 1700 sq ft this is a rare opportunity for anyone looking to secure a substantial home on one of the most iconic and exclusive streets in the city. The ground floor features a study to the front with a bedroom and convenient shower room. Parking in the area is via residents permits but this house also features an integrated garage with enough room to park a car. The first floor us comprised of a kitchen breakfast room with enough space for a dining table and a large sitting room which spans the width of the property. Double doors open onto a Juliet balcony which opens onto Princess Victoria Street. There is also a well maintained, manageable courtyard garden The top floor then has the master bedroom with en suite shower room, a family bathroom and a spare double bedroom. This property is advertised with no onward chain.
